Understanding Energy-Efficient Roofing

What Makes a Roof Energy Efficient?

Energy-efficient roofs are designed to minimize heat absorption and maximize heat reflection, reducing the need for air conditioning. In Southern California’s hot climate, a roof that reflects more sunlight and absorbs less heat can lower cooling costs significantly. The U.S. Department of Energy estimates that cool roofs can reduce energy bills by up to 30%. Factors such as material type, color, and thermal emittance determine a roof’s energy efficiency.

Cool roofs utilize materials like reflective coatings and surfaces that maintain a lower temperature than traditional roofs. This technology not only saves energy but also extends the lifespan of the roof by reducing thermal expansion. Top Energy-Efficient Roofing Types

Cool Roofs

Cool roofs are designed to reflect more sunlight and absorb less heat than standard roofs. They are typically made from highly reflective materials, including light-colored coatings and single-ply membranes like TPO and PVC. Cool roofs can lower roof surface temperatures by up to 50°F, significantly reducing heat transfer into the building.

Cool roofing materials are especially beneficial in sunny climates like California, where they can dramatically cut cooling costs. Metal Roofing

Metal roofing is a durable and energy-efficient option for commercial buildings. Metal roofs reflect solar radiation effectively, reducing cooling loads. They can be installed with reflective coatings to enhance energy efficiency further. Metal roofs are also long-lasting, often exceeding 50 years of service life, as discussed in our comparison of roofing material lifespan for commercial roofs.

Green Roofs

Green roofs, also known as living roofs, are covered with vegetation and soil, providing excellent insulation and energy efficiency. They absorb rainwater, provide natural cooling, and reduce energy consumption by insulating the building. Green roofs also offer aesthetic and ecological benefits, enhancing urban biodiversity.

Although the initial costs of installing a green roof can be high, they offer long-term savings through reduced energy bills and increased roof lifespan. They also contribute to LEED certification points, which can be advantageous for businesses pursuing sustainability credentials.

Cost and Longevity

While initial installation costs are a major consideration, it’s important to evaluate the long-term benefits of energy-efficient roofing. Metal and green roofs may have higher upfront costs compared to traditional options, but they often pay off through energy savings and reduced maintenance costs over time.

Here is a comparison of costs and longevity for various roofing types:

Roofing Type Average Cost/Sq Ft Expected Lifespan
Cool Roofs $7 – $10 20 – 30 years
Metal Roofing $8 – $12 40 – 70 years
Green Roofs $15 – $25 30 – 50 years

Frequently Asked Questions

How do cool roofs differ from traditional roofing?

Cool roofs are designed to reflect more sunlight and absorb less heat, making them ideal for hot climates. Traditional roofs, by contrast, often absorb more heat, increasing cooling costs. Cool roofs can significantly lower utility bills and enhance comfort.

Are there financial incentives for installing energy-efficient roofs?

Yes, many states and local governments offer tax credits and incentives for installing energy-efficient roofing systems. These incentives can help offset the initial installation costs. Learn more about maximizing savings with commercial roofing energy tax credits.

What maintenance is required for green roofs?

Green roofs require regular maintenance, including watering, weeding, and checking the integrity of the waterproofing membrane. However, they offer long-term benefits, such as energy savings and increased roof lifespan, which can justify the maintenance efforts.

Can energy-efficient roofs improve indoor air quality?

Yes, energy-efficient roofs can improve indoor air quality by reducing the need for air conditioning, which often recirculates indoor air. Green roofs, in particular, can enhance air quality by filtering pollutants and providing natural cooling.
